【Controls】
・Use the arrow keys or the WASD keys to change the snake's direction.
・Press the Escape key (ESC) to pause the game.
【How to Play】
1 Select a difficulty level on the home screen.
There are three options: "NORMAL," "EASY," and "HARD."
The snake's movement speed changes depending on the difficulty level.
2 Select a game mode.
There are two modes: "Eat Half" and "Eat It All."
- In "Eat Half," you win by growing the snake to cover 40 tiles.
- In "Eat It All," you win by covering all 81 tiles with the snake.
